Although Jeep got plenty of attention for the Rescue concept vehicle that debuted in Detroit earlier this year, no one figured anything like it would ever see a showroom floor. Recent spy photos suggest otherwise, however, as the prototypes bear the same kind of boxy, over the top styling as the concept. Built on the same platform as the new Grand Cherokee, the Commander will be slightly larger and incorporate a third row of seats. Hemi power will no doubt be part of the package along with plenty of built in off road ability.

With a 3rd baby on the way it was out with the Jeep Liberty and in with the Commander. I knew that the Grand Cherokee would not help us out much on space as my mother drives one daily. So give me a Hemi, 3 rows of seats,ESP,side air bags, anti lock, awesome 4 low and all time 4x4 system ( when Jeep says low 4 they mean low 4, wrap it in black keep the cheesy chrome off it and have a good day.
13mpg on average 18mpg if I am a good boy. Yeah gas millage sucks but so does not having enough power to get up MT Pilchuck,Stevens Pass, or the Grape Vine. If you are looking for a dainty "green" vehicle, this is not for you.
If you have a family and want a vehicle that you can get out and enjoy the remote areas of our awesome land, and not have to worry about getting there or back, this Jeep is for you.
Awesome in snow, Rain, and mud. The owners manual states not to exceed 20 inches in water...oops I went 48...With no problem at all
